A collection of works from Cyril Vernon Connolly, an English literary critic and writer. This set contains: The Rock Pool, 1936. First US edition. Connolly's only novel, set at the end of season in a small resort in the south of France we follow Naylor, who begins a study of the decadent inhabitants of the resort. The Condemned Playground, 1946. First US edition. A collection of thirty-seven essays found to be mildly political and amusingly witty. Enemies of Promise, 1948. Revised edition. A collection of essays in three parts: Predicament, The Charlock's Shade, and A Georgian Boyhood. Ideas and Places, 1953. Second impression. A collection of essays and articles originally released as his "Comments" from Horizon, arranged into a singular narrative. The Golden Horizon, 1953. First edition. Setting out to compress over six hundred issues of the magazine Horizon into one complete volume. Previous Convictions, 1963. First edition. A selection of writings from a decade of work, being important essays from Connolly written since the release of his work Ideas and Places. The Modern Movement, 1966. First US edition. A selection of descriptions of the one hundred books that best define the Modern Movement, beginning as a revolt against the Bourgeois in France and the Victorians in England. The Evening Colonnade, 1975. Uncorrected proof. A collection of essays and reviews consisting primarily of articles written when Connolly was chief book reviewer for The Sunday Times. Cyril Connolly, 1984. First US edition. A biographical study of the life of Cyril Connolly, written by David Eugene Henry Pryce-Jones, a British conservative author, historian and political commentator. In the original full cloth binding.
